Emergency Medical Services (EMS) is dedicated to providing out-of-hospital medical care to patients suffering from illness or injuries. The EMS system includes 9-1-1 Dispatchers, First Responders, Emergency Medical Technicians (EMT's), and Paramedics. In the City of Murrieta, the Fire Department is responsible for providing EMS services to the community. The Murrieta Fire Department is equipped with the training, personnel and tools necessary to respond timely to any emergency.

Paramedics and EMT's are trained to recognize and treat life-threatening conditions, such as heart attack and stroke. Quick and accurate medical decision-making by Murrieta EMT's and Paramedics is vital to patient safety and definitive hospital treatment. EMS also strives to maintain the health and safety of the community through public safety services, such as community education, including CPR and First-Aid and now through Integrated Community Healthcare.
